A case of fatal pemphigus vulgaris in association with beta interferon and interleukin-2 therapy.

W L Ramseur1, F Richards, D B Duggan.   

Abstract

Beta interferon (beta-IFN) and interleukin-2 (IL-2) have been utilized in experimental cancer therapy because of their effects on the immune system. We report here a patient treated with IL-2 and beta-IFN who rapidly developed an immune-mediated, bullous exfoliative dermatitis and who ultimately died. Various etiologic mechanisms are proposed.
